Adjective
- 1 Of or pertaining to the formation of rock. not-comparable
"Silica and alumina are distinctly the most abundant and characteristic petrogenic constituents, and with them are most frequently associated those elements toward the extreme petrogenic end of the periodic table, especially potassium, sodium, and calcium in the order named; and these elements are associated with each other."
- 2 Produced by the incomplete combustion of petroleum not-comparable
